首页 > 其他分享 >Nexus-Nuget

Nexus-Nuget

时间:2024-04-02 17:25:47浏览次数:22  
标签:cn Nexus Image jpg Nuget com

  • Nexus地址

https://nexus.bgy.com.cn/#browse/search/nuget 

  • Nuget包仓库地址

https://nexus.bgy.com.cn/repository/bu00160-nuget-snapshots

https://nexus.bgy.com.cn/repository/bu00160-nuget-releases

  • Vs添加Nuget包源

步骤:

选中要添加的项目,右击--->管理Nuget程序包--->点击红色箭头指向的【设置】,弹出程序包源管理界面

点击+是的添加Nexus_Nuget包源

名称:Bgy.Bdr.Nexus

地址:https://nexus.bgy.com.cn/repository/bu00160-nuget-snapshots

按照下图操作即可:

右上角,程序包源切换到包源:Bgy.Bdr.Nexus,就可以看到我们自己的Nuget包了

  • Vs添加Nuget包

选择需要的Nuget包,安装到我们的项目中

  • Nuget包发布

1、安装Nuget.exe工具

nuget.exe

该工具必须安装,不然不可以发布Nuget包,当然,如果你不需要发布Nuget包,可以不用安装

该工具可以通过命令制作和发布Nuget包,喜欢命令的兄弟姐妹,可以参考最下面的网文

2、制作Nuget包步骤

PackageExplorer.4.4.72.zip

这种方式,适合习惯界面操作,制作和发布Nuget包的兄弟姐妹

粗略步骤如下:

解压,打开NuGetPackageExplorer.exe

添加Nuget包文件,修改Nuget包内容,保存,然后发布

Publish Url:https://nexus.bgy.com.cn/repository/bu00160-nuget-snapshots

Publish Key:需要管理员授权开通

详细步骤参考最下面的网文

  • Nuget包源代码地址

https://git.bgy.com.cn/bu00160/slxt-opensdk-backend.git

要求:提供Nuget源代码的同时,必须附带Demo和(简单说明)Readme.txt

 

网文:

https://www.cnblogs.com/hunternet/p/9233241.html

https://www.cnblogs.com/wcrBlog/archive/2004/01/13/12273956.html

https://blog.csdn.net/a1946433096/article/details/104973138/?utm_medium=distribute.pc_relevant.none-task-blog-title-2&spm=1001.2101.3001.4242

 

标签:cn,Nexus,Image,jpg,Nuget,com
From: https://www.cnblogs.com/xionghui23/p/18111077

相关文章

  • nexus 代理 pypi
    环境说明服务ip端口备注nexus192.168.80.129(内网)8081内网地址无法访问外网nginx192.168.80.128(内网)192.168.174.126(外网) 8819000192.168.174.126地址可以访问外网创建 BlobStores创建Repositories设置proxyrepo测试#p......
  • nexus 代理 epel 源
    服务ip端口备注nexus192.168.80.129(内网)8081内网地址无法访问外网nginx192.168.80.128(内网)192.168.174.126(外网)19000192.168.174.126地址可以访问外网创建 BlobStores创建Repositoriesnginx配置server{listen1900......
  • .NET C#导出解决方案的NuGet依赖关系
    前言公司项目需要写DS设计文档,文档需要标识出来你的解决方案文件下的所有项目都使用了NuGet哪些第三方依赖,我们都知道sln下面的所有.csproj文件中的节点下会标识出对应的依赖,但一个一个对比又太麻烦(主要是懒),有时候一个sln能有10几个project项目,能不能写脚本一键导出这些依赖关......
  • vue/react- 报错Unable to authenticate, need: BASIC realm=“Sonatype Nexus Reposi
    问题描述在vue/react(node.js)项目中,node安装依赖install装包时报错:Unabletoauthenticate,need:BASICrealm=“SonatypeNexusRepositoryManager“如果我们报错差不多,就可以完美解决。解决方法这个问题,其实......
  • nexus 代理 npm
    环境说明服务ip端口备注nexus192.168.80.129(内网)8081内网地址无法访问外网nginx192.168.80.128(内网)192.168.174.126(外网)代理端口88192.168.174.126地址可以访问外网创建 BlobStores创建Repositories设置proxyrepo测试安装cnp......
  • 使用Nexus搭建私服:加速依赖管理和提高项目稳定性
    在软件开发过程中,依赖管理是至关重要的一环。随着项目的增长和复杂性的提升,对于依赖库的管理变得越来越复杂。为了解决这一问题,搭建一个私有的仓库是一个明智的选择。本文将介绍如何使用Nexus搭建私服,并利用其来加速依赖管理和提高项目稳定性。什么是Nexus?Nexus是一款强大......
  • nexus 代理 go
    创建 BlobStores创建Repositoriesnginx配置server{listen19000;server_namelocalhost;#设置代理访问日志access_loglogs/yum.access.log;error_loglogs/yum.error.log;location/goproxy/{ proxy_passhtt......
  • docker compose 部署 nexus3
    创建数据目录mkdir-pv/data/nexus/nexus-data&&chown-R200/data/nexus/nexus-datadocker-compose.yamlversion:'3'services:nexus3:image:sonatype/nexus3:3.66.0container_name:nexus3restart:alwaysenvironment:......
  • 批量上传本地Maven仓库jar包到Nexus私服
    创建import.sh脚本,写入以下内容#!/bin/bash#copyandrunthisscripttotherootoftherepositorydirectorycontainingfiles#thisscriptattemptstoexcludeuploadingitselfexplicitlysothescriptnameisimportant#Getcommandlineparamswhilegetopt......
  • nexus如何上传自己的依赖包
    一、创建第三方包仓库创建第三方jar包的仓库选用hosted取名为nexus-3rd然后再public组中加入nexus-3rd,交给public管理二、创建用户仓库创建完成以后可以创建一个管理的用户third:third123三、上传jar包1.使用网页上传点击upload,选择三方库输入对应的数据,完成上传2.使用cmd命......